Brian Best, MAOL has a diverse work experience spanning over several years. Brian began their career as a Youth Pastor at Grace Bible Church in 1994, where they served until 1999. Following this, Brian worked as a Youth Pastor at Lakewood Park Ministries from 1999 to 2015. In 2015, they joined Ambassador Enterprises, LLC as a Non Profit Portfolio Optimizer, focusing on cultivating legacies through purpose, people, and performance. Brian later became a Director in 2018, and in 2021, they assumed the role of Director - Community Advocate. Brian Best, MAOL, has a strong educational background in leadership and ministry. Brian obtained a Master of Arts (MA) degree in Organizational Leadership from Huntington University from 2015 to 2017. Prior to that, they pursued a Bachelor of Science (BS) degree in Bible with a focus on Youth Ministry at Clarks Summit University from 1991 to 1994.

In addition to their academic achievements, Brian Best has also acquired certifications to enhance their professional skills. Brian obtained certification as a Certified Strategic Doing Workshop Leader from the Strategic Doing Institute in April 2021. Furthermore, in May 2017, they became a Professional/Executive Coach after completing the required training at the Townsend Institute.
